Research Associate

Toronto

The Center for Advanced Diffusion-Wave and Photoacoustic Technologies (CADIPT) at the University of Toronto is a research lab focused on the developing photothermal and photoacoustic imaging technologies for biomedical applications. The lab integrates advanced optical and acoustic methods to address challenges in non-invasive diagnostic and medical imaging.1. Medical Device Development: Designed and built imaging systems for biomedical applications, integrating high-precision optical components and ensuring compliance with medical device standards.2. Optical and Prototype Design: Utilized ZEMAX and CAD software for optical and mechanical system design, developing prototypes and ensuring precise alignment for optimal system functionality and performance.3. Image Analysis : Developed advanced signal processing algorithms in MATLAB and Python, significantly improving the quality of optical signals and imaging outputs, with published results in Science Advances.4. Machine Learning: Managed large-scale imaging datasets and utilized machine learning techniques to optimize system performance and enhance diagnostic accuracy.5. Clinical Support: Provided imaging (Thermal, Optical, and Micro-CT) and data analysis for a clinical study exploring dental enamel anomalies as potential biomarkers of childhood adversity.6. Preclinical Research: Conducted wet lab research and animal handling to support preclinical imaging experiments and validate biomedical imaging systems.

Graduate Research Assistant

Waterloo, Ontario, Canada

School of Optometry and Vision Science, University of Waterloo, a leading institution in vision science and optometry education, renowned for cutting-edge research in ocular health and optical technologies.1. Developed optical systems: Designed and calibrated wavefront sensors to measure refractive errors and optical aberrations in the human eye.2. Experiment Design: Designed experiments to investigate ocular imperfections including refractive errors, and aphakia, evaluating the efficacy of spectacle corrections and intraocular lenses (IOLs) for vision restoration3. Optical Quality Assessments: Calculated PSF, MTF, and Strehl ratio to evaluate retinal image quality and the optical performance of ophthalmic devices.4. Visual acuity analysis: Analyzed factors impacting visual acuity in clinical studies and product development, providing insights into optimizing optical devices for improved vision outcomes.5. Algorithm Development: Improved image processing, signal analysis, and noise reduction for enhanced device performance.
